+/*
+ * Uses a linked list right now, but should be hash tables on the keys we use.
+ */
+#include <config.h>
+#include <stdio.h>
+#include <sys/queue.h>
+
+#define __STDC_FORMAT_MACROS
+#include <inttypes.h>
+
+#include <LongBow/runtime.h>
+#include <parc/algol/parc_Memory.h>
+
+#include <ccnx/transport/transport_rta/core/rta_Framework_Services.h>
+#include <ccnx/transport/transport_rta/core/rta_ConnectionTable.h>
+
+#define DEBUG_OUTPUT 0
+
+typedef struct rta_connection_entry {
+ RtaConnection *connection;
+
+ TAILQ_ENTRY(rta_connection_entry) list;
+} RtaConnectionEntry;
+
+struct rta_connection_table {
+ size_t max_elements;
+ size_t count_elements;
+ TableFreeFunc *freefunc;
+ TAILQ_HEAD(, rta_connection_entry) head;
+};
+
+
+/**
+ * Create a connection table of the given size
+ *
+ * Example:
+ * @code
+ * <#example#>
+ * @endcode
+ */
+RtaConnectionTable *
+rtaConnectionTable_Create(size_t elements, TableFreeFunc *freefunc)
+{
+ RtaConnectionTable *table = parcMemory_AllocateAndClear(sizeof(RtaConnectionTable));
+ assertNotNull(table, "parcMemory_AllocateAndClear(%zu) returned NULL", sizeof(RtaConnectionTable));
+ TAILQ_INIT(&table->head);
+ table->max_elements = elements;
+ table->count_elements = 0;
+ table->freefunc = freefunc;
+ return table;
+}
+
+/**
+ * Destroy the connection table, and it will call rtaConnection_Destroy()
+ * on each connection in the table.
+ *
+ * Example:
+ * @code
+ * <#example#>
+ * @endcode
+ */
+void
+rtaConnectionTable_Destroy(RtaConnectionTable **tablePtr)
+{
+ RtaConnectionTable *table;
+
+ assertNotNull(tablePtr, "Called with null parameter");
+ table = *tablePtr;
+ assertNotNull(table, "Called with parameter that dereferences to null");
+
+ while (!TAILQ_EMPTY(&table->head)) {
+ RtaConnectionEntry *entry = TAILQ_FIRST(&table->head);
+ TAILQ_REMOVE(&table->head, entry, list);
+ if (table->freefunc) {
+ table->freefunc(&entry->connection);
+ }
+ parcMemory_Deallocate((void **) &entry);
+ }
+
+ parcMemory_Deallocate((void **) &table);
+ *tablePtr = NULL;
+}
+
+/**
+ * Add a connetion to the table. Stores the reference provided (does not copy).
+ * Returns 0 on success, -1 on error
+ *
+ * Example:
+ * @code
+ * <#example#>
+ * @endcode
+ */
+int
+rtaConnectionTable_AddConnection(RtaConnectionTable *table, RtaConnection *connection)
+{
+ assertNotNull(table, "Called with null parameter RtaConnectionTable");
+ assertNotNull(connection, "Called with null parameter RtaConnection");
+
+ if (table->count_elements < table->max_elements) {
+ table->count_elements++;
+ RtaConnectionEntry *entry = parcMemory_AllocateAndClear(sizeof(RtaConnectionEntry));
+ assertNotNull(entry, "parcMemory_AllocateAndClear(%zu) returned NULL", sizeof(RtaConnectionEntry));
+ entry->connection = connection;
+ TAILQ_INSERT_TAIL(&table->head, entry, list);
+ return 0;
+ }
+ return -1;
+}
+
+/**
+ * Lookup a connection.
+ * Returns NULL if not found
+ *
+ * Example:
+ * @code
+ * <#example#>
+ * @endcode
+ */
+RtaConnection *
+rtaConnectionTable_GetByApiFd(RtaConnectionTable *table, int api_fd)
+{
+ assertNotNull(table, "Called with null parameter RtaConnectionTable");
+
+ RtaConnectionEntry *entry;
+ TAILQ_FOREACH(entry, &table->head, list)
+ {
+ if (rtaConnection_GetApiFd(entry->connection) == api_fd) {
+ return entry->connection;
+ }
+ }
+ return NULL;
+}
+
+/**
+ * Lookup a connection.
+ * Returns NULL if not found
+ *
+ * Example:
+ * @code
+ * <#example#>
+ * @endcode
+ */
+RtaConnection *
+rtaConnectionTable_GetByTransportFd(RtaConnectionTable *table, int transport_fd)
+{
+ assertNotNull(table, "Called with null parameter RtaConnectionTable");
+
+ RtaConnectionEntry *entry;
+ TAILQ_FOREACH(entry, &table->head, list)
+ {
+ if (rtaConnection_GetTransportFd(entry->connection) == transport_fd) {
+ return entry->connection;
+ }
+ }
+ return NULL;
+}
+
+
+/**
+ * Remove a connection from the table, calling rtaConnection_Destroy() on it.
+ * Returns 0 on success, -1 if not found (or error)
+ *
+ * Example:
+ * @code
+ * <#example#>
+ * @endcode
+ */
+int
+rtaConnectionTable_Remove(RtaConnectionTable *table, RtaConnection *connection)
+{
+ assertNotNull(table, "Called with null parameter RtaConnectionTable");
+ assertNotNull(connection, "Called with null parameter RtaConnection");
+
+ RtaConnectionEntry *entry;
+ TAILQ_FOREACH(entry, &table->head, list)
+ {
+ if (entry->connection == connection) {
+ assertTrue(table->count_elements > 0, "Invalid state, found an entry, but count_elements is zero");
+ table->count_elements--;
+ TAILQ_REMOVE(&table->head, entry, list);
+ if (table->freefunc) {
+ table->freefunc(&entry->connection);
+ }
+ parcMemory_Deallocate((void **) &entry);
+ return 0;
+ }
+ }
+ return -1;
+}
+
+/**
+ * Remove all connections in a given stack_id, calling rtaConnection_Destroy() on it.
+ * Returns 0 on success, -1 if not found (or error)
+ *
+ * Example:
+ * @code
+ * <#example#>
+ * @endcode
+ */
+int
+rtaConnectionTable_RemoveByStack(RtaConnectionTable *table, int stack_id)
+{
+ assertNotNull(table, "Called with null parameter RtaConnectionTable");
+
+ RtaConnectionEntry *entry = TAILQ_FIRST(&table->head);
+ while (entry != NULL) {
+ RtaConnectionEntry *temp = TAILQ_NEXT(entry, list);
+ if (rtaConnection_GetStackId(entry->connection) == stack_id) {
+ assertTrue(table->count_elements > 0, "Invalid state, found an entry, but count_elements is zero");
+ table->count_elements--;
+
+ if (DEBUG_OUTPUT) {
+ printf("%9" PRIu64 "%s stack_id %d conn %p\n",
+ rtaFramework_GetTicks(rtaConnection_GetFramework(entry->connection)),
+ __func__,
+ stack_id,
+ (void *) entry->connection);
+ }
+
+ TAILQ_REMOVE(&table->head, entry, list);
+ if (table->freefunc) {
+ table->freefunc(&entry->connection);
+ }
+
+ if (DEBUG_OUTPUT) {
+ printf("%9s %s FREEFUNC RETURNS\n",
+ " ", __func__);
+ }
+
+ parcMemory_Deallocate((void **) &entry);
+ }
+ entry = temp;
+ }
+ return 0;
+}
